What to eat near North Idaho College

Here are some famous dishes near North Idaho College, Coeur d'Alene, Idaho, United States of America:

  • Steak: A popular choice in North Idaho, you'll find locally sourced cuts grilled to perfection, often seasoned simply with salt and pepper to highlight the natural flavors. Many restaurants serve it with sides like Idaho potatoes or seasonal vegetables, making it a hearty meal to enjoy while taking in the local scenery.
  • Burgers: The region boasts some fantastic burger joints that pride themselves on using fresh, locally sourced ingredients. Expect to find gourmet options topped with unique local ingredients like huckleberry sauce or blue cheese, allowing for a personalized culinary experience. Enjoying a burger at a patio with views of Coeur d'Alene Lake can be a delightful experience, reflecting the casual yet vibrant dining culture of the area.

Best time to go to North Idaho College

North Idaho College experiences its lowest average temperature in December, at 27.5°F (-2.5°C), while July is the hottest month, with an average temperature of 70.7°F (21.5°C). December tends to be the wettest month. The peak travel months to visit North Idaho College are February, August, and September, which see a higher number of tourists. During this peak period, the weather is sunny to mostly cloudy, accompanied by no to light rainfall. In contrast, March, May, and November are ideal if you're looking for a calmer vacation, marked by light rainfall and mostly sunny to mostly cloudy conditions.
